#159354 Relay Network Protocol

Posted by Zee on 05 January 2014 - 09:26 AM in APIs and Utilities

Relay Network Protocol (RNP) is a simple peer-to-peer network protocol, created by ericjet91, who kindly asked me to post this on the forums for him. RNP is available in API form as well as a relay using the specification (RNPRelay).
